Cendyn reorients leadership to tackle AI challenges

Cendyn, a global hospitality technology company, has announced a strategic leadership reorientation under CEO Michael Bennett, who assumed the role in late 2025. This move is designed to address the evolving challenges in hotel marketing, particularly those posed by AI-powered booking channels and changing traveller behaviours.

Bennett, who has been with Cendyn for a decade, emphasised the importance of understanding the operational realities faced by hoteliers. "Our new leadership team has sat on both sides of the vendor relationship," he stated, highlighting their experience in managing hotel operations and technology solutions. This insight is crucial as Cendyn aims to bridge the gap between technology promises and practical delivery.

The restructured team focuses on providing proactive account management and commercial consultation, ensuring that hoteliers can respond effectively to new demand signals. Cendyn Managed Services offers hands-on optimisation and strategic guidance, with success measured by revenue outcomes rather than renewals.

Victoria Curley, Head of Commercial at Roomzzz Aparthotels, praised the partnership, noting the structured dialogue around goals and CRM usage. Jenna Villalobos, Chief Revenue Officer at Outrigger Hospitality Group, echoed this sentiment, citing a clear direction from Cendyn's leadership that has translated into tangible results.

Pierre Langelotti, Director of E-Commerce at ONYX Hospitality Group, remarked on the improved support in Asia, which has reduced operational friction and allowed a focus on future opportunities. As Cendyn transitions to its latest CRM platform, the company aims to elevate the digital experience for guests.

Cendyn, established in 1996, continues to evolve its product suite to support hotels across the guest journey, ensuring they remain competitive in the next generation of AI-driven channels
